Transaction 87c956640b043f72f1c788758ee4c871e152aba2f75b98701a331d4d56d5ece9
1 Input
1 Output
-
87c956640b043f72f1c788758ee4c871e152aba2f75b98701a331d4d56d5ece9:0
- value
- 31934
- script pubkey
- OP_0 OP_PUSHBYTES_20 39f1c53e7c0a7ee06fdcc1a22dc2c3aa29bb65d2
- address
- bc1q88cu20nupflwqm7ucx3zmskr4g5mkewj4ykch7